Yeah very slightly, the first one looks less like a pod compared to the last one. I think that is the picture that got me a bit worried. Do females still grow pods?

Thanks for the help!
 
its a pod like a seed pod ,tapers at end with 2 very fine hairs from it. a male is more pod shaped,no hairs,has stalks . the pods multiply then burst open and release pollen.

That's a big help, thank you! Do the hairs start off very slightly green or are they white from the word go?

Also, is there anything you can do with a male plant? I don't have anything else growing, and I'd hate to see all my hard work go to waste!

Sorry for all the questions!
 
you could let him flower and save the pollen, then when you have a nice female you could pollinate a few lower buds and get some seeds. yeah slightly green is ok then getting whiter later and longer, you wont be confused for long. check out my envirolite 12-12 from seed journal if you get time. anything else you need just ask.
